Megan started her gymnastics career with Delta in 1989 and was Delta’s first ever Gymnast of the Year. Megan then retired as a gymnast and commenced coaching as a trainee and progressed to becoming a Senior Coach, working with children from two years of age, just beginning in gymnastics, to National Champions.
As a senior female coach, Megan has prepared many Delta Teams and individual state champions on apparatus and overall. In her coaching career, Megan placed girls on the State and National teams and was selected as coach for both Queensland and Australia.
In 2005, Megan was selected as one of four female coaches to be mentored by the National Coach. With this selection, Megan was given the opportunity to be tutored by the top coaches in Australia and travelled to Canberra to view training of the Australian teams in their preparation for major international meets. In 2007, Megan was named Gymnastics Queensland National Stream Coach of the year.
Megan has her Bachelor of Education and taught at Somerville House in Brisbane for three years. In addition, in 2004 Megan was awarded National Stream Judge of the Year and qualified as an FIG judge (eligible to judge internationally) for the 2005 – 2008 Olympic Cycle. Megan holds the accreditation of Advanced Silver Coach in Australia.
Megan’s focus is to now provide support to our staff in the design and implementation of our programs to provide exceptional experiences for Delta members.
